摘要: ① 懒汉式:经典写法,线程不安全 public class Singleton { private static Singleton instance; //私有静态自身类属性,由于静态方法只能访问静态成员,因此是静态的 private Singleton (){} //私有构造器 public s 阅读全文
posted @ 2017-04-14 11:37 风碎月 阅读(142) 评论(0) 推荐(0) 编辑
摘要: 单例模式:确保一个类中只有一个实例,并提供一个全局访问点。 1. 常见的单例模式使用场景: 1.1 Servlet 一个WEB容器可以存在多个Servlet,但是别忘记了,在WEB容器中,每个Servlet都仅仅只有一个唯一实例。在Servlet的生命周期中,当WEB容器启动的时候会根据web.xm 阅读全文
posted @ 2017-04-05 19:56 风碎月 阅读(139) 评论(0) 推荐(0) 编辑
摘要: 编译可以通过,运行结果如下: 那么,Null作为参数的时候究竟如何调用函数?回答这个问题之前,先来看看其他例子。 通过上述代码可以知道,4个test()函数,当null作为实参进行调用的时候,会根据继承的关系,调用最底层子类的test()函数,当第四个test()方法不注释的时候,由于String类 阅读全文
posted @ 2017-03-17 22:18 风碎月 阅读(1193) 评论(0) 推荐(0) 编辑